Output bbd4a3e51f3b577f81f80fd65cef0322a135dc60f4c413b902330cabda6b5b8a:0

value
68010663
script pubkey
OP_0 OP_PUSHBYTES_20 13f88d5c2706d4f51dcc397dd56483bd0ec7756d
address
bc1qz0ug6hp8qm2028wv897a2eyrh58vwatd3ev4t7
transaction
bbd4a3e51f3b577f81f80fd65cef0322a135dc60f4c413b902330cabda6b5b8a
confirmations
214491
spent
true